After Deva Devam, Swagatham Krishna, now it's time for a poem written by the great telugu poet 'Bammera Pothana', as to the title director used that poem from 'Mahabhagavatam' - Gajendra Moksha shatkam.
"ఆలా వైకుంఠపురంబులో నగరిలో మూలసాధంబు దా
పల మందార వానఅంతరామృతసార్వప్రాంతేందుకాంతోపలో
త్పల పర్యనక రామవినోది యగు నాపన్నప్రసాన్నుండు వి
హ్వల నాగేంద్రము పాహి పాహి యన గుయ్యాలుంచి సంరంభియై "
Which means- "In that Vaikunta abode , in the beautiful Palace near lotus pool,on the bed of flowers, Lord Sri
Hari was playing dice with his consort Sri Lakshmi "!! So, nice that now'a'days movies too feature such great epics in the films. Thanks to Trivikram.
